Output efffb21d74a68d9e951e62bdbdde36447ea9781d11872c6afda37d50bc38be7d:0

value
1027959441
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25ca9b89a23503926a2ffad70c3959214c5cb15e OP_EQUALVERIFY OP_CHECKSIG
address
14SpiX4uwwYLEQKZqHjRy8xFZBg6P1mGcZ
transaction
efffb21d74a68d9e951e62bdbdde36447ea9781d11872c6afda37d50bc38be7d
spent
true